KENNETH RUOFF CLASS LETTER January 5, 1959 Dear Class of '59, Once again it is my pleasure to express best wishes to a class who has completed another step inthe educational ladder. Your stay in the junior high has been one of joy, frustration, anxiety, and hope. You have encountered many new experiences and I sincerely hope you have learned from each one. Greatest learning sometimes is the result of what appeared to be a failure at the moment. To make mistakes is human, but to fail to profit from them is tragic. From your forefathers, you have in- herited one of the finest ways of life ever developed. Opportunities in America are unlimited. With recent scientific develop- ments, you may witness a standard of living which would have been beyond all expectation a few short years ago. To live in this world of tomorrow will require highly skilled people in all areas. You must be prepared to live in this age of electronic devices, atomic energy, and space travel. To ade- quately prepare will necessitate developing your abilities to the fullest. The opportunity to search out and pre- pare will be afforded you. Will you meet the challenge? The extent to which you de- velop your talents will determine the future of our American way of life. Sincerely, Kenneth Ruoff, Principal at MRS. Q A ww ,5Kx,1w5,.y,ifQ5,i55e- 555:g,f5g,fg5f1,3,sQ,,geggm,Qggww , isz553.s-PmE:?i,LMu5zf4.re Laif'f'.ifiD?we2w2?L'3S:E9K'Avi5A.,Qsa-33 31 SymmegfwQmWaSMQQwQJmw,.ww Lwmfwm wfmw-S,wA,,91.Ws, V,.ww,W.wmfwf,,Q A HALLGJARDS The hallguard staff is the oldest organization in our school. Under the guidance of their sponsor, Mr. Brisbane, the hallguards have the responsibility of keeping order in the hall and assisting visitors. Sherron MacCalla is Captain, and Kathy Rahl is assistant CAMERA CLUB The Camera Club, sponsored by Mr. Taylor, had a very busy year learning to take, develop, print, and enlarge pictures. They also made field trips to study unusual photo- graphy. To join this club, you do not have to own a camera, but should have access to one. Captain. CHORUS This year our chorus is composed of eighth and ninth grade students. They entertained us at as- semblies during the year and also presented an excellent Spring Concert. Mrs. Kent is the director of the chorus. DRAMATICS CLUB This club provides an opportunity for students to display and further their dramatic ability. The Dramatics Club, directed by Mr. George, is a wonderful club for anyone interested in acting. STUDENT COUNCIL 1 Student Council has done a fine job this year under the leadership of Kathy Rahl, presidentg John Skiavo, vice-presidentg Gwen Gosnell, secretaryg and Riston Forsythe, treasurer. The sponsors were Mr. Mansour and Mr. Antonacci. NEWSPAPER The club consisted of eight girls and six boys who devoted their spare time to making the school newspaper. We appreciate the time and effort the staff has put forth to make the paper a success. The sponsors were Mr. Mansour and Mr. Antonacci. l 2 Z 3 1 5 5 f ? Q i 3 5 5 s f 5 2 E S Z Q W L1 EIGHTH CHEERLEADERS Names left to right: Beverly Skillings, Dorothy Smith, Donna Smith, Kathy Turner, Kathy Krupy, Sandy Scherer, Carol Costello, and Connie Borkovich. Miss Trogola is the sponsor. These girls make-up the ninth grade Cheerleaders. The girls left to right are: Kathy Rahl Co-captain, Karen Keenan, Virginia Lauricia, and Carol Chellman, Captain. The girls did a wonderi ful job by cheering our team on to many victories this year. Miss Trogola is their sponsor. H-'F' .imr s s ! K 5 1 1 5, S is I JR. F.H.A. The Jr. F.H.A. is a group of girls who meet every other week. Mrs. Weisenfluh, sponsor of the club, had them working on useful projects, which will benefit them in the future. SR. F.H.A. This club, which consists of eleven girls, did knitting, sewing, and small handicraft projects. Under the direction of Mrs. Davis, the girls have learned the essentials of homemaking. 3 l 1 3 s 3 i 5 E f E 3 s Y 5 4 X 3 1 1 3 5 5 A 5 5 i f 5 5 3 2 5 3 X Y L K Q 5 3 5 JR. HISTORIANS The Jr. Historians consists of forty members. Under the guidance of Mr. Shaffer, the club is to report on a state given topic at a yearly spring convention. BOYS ART CLUB This club is composed of twenty industrious boys who are interested in art work. Directed by Mrs. Wuenschel, the boys did leatherwork during the first half of the year and enameling in the second half of the year. T AVIATION CLUB This club, consisting of 35 boys, is divided into two groups. Under the guidance of Mr. Stewart, their sponsor, the boys are working on general aviation and model planes. FIRE CAPTAINS This group of 50 pupils have the final inspection of the school after a fire drill. The sponsor is Mr. Ruoff. . 6 2 2 X w f E s 5 1 J S STAGE CREW This is agroup of 10 energetic boys. They take care of the conditions on the stage and any situation that may arise. The sponsor is Mr. Antonacci. NURSES CLUB Mrs. Tempero has been with the Nurses Club for six years. This year she has taught the girls first aid. 3 f E S 2 S 5 2 Q 3 3 E e 5 S f L 'E 3 SAFETY CLUB The safety club is probably one ofthe most constructive clubs in the school. Mr. Antonacci, the sponsor ofthe club, has them meet on every available Monday. During the meetings they learn the different safety rules and study pamphlets on civil defense. . ? :.::Z'?T B, f-4, 5 , -V Km, 5.g,5,a...g55., . r , . , . .ggi ,, J.. -5 ,. 5.5 sif t.: i N ii x .Q jf H mfg, 4 f if HSE? si! . - ' . , .- . FRESHMEN HISTORY As the 1959 school year comes to a close we look back on the three years we have spent as apart of the Harrold student body, three years of classes, activities, and friends. These thoughts are now a part of our memories. While some of these will fade, others will remain vividly with us. There is not one among us who can forget that day in 56 when we entered Harrold for the first time. It was a confusing maze of halls and rooms, full of unfamiliar faces. As the months passed we lost most of our bewilderment and began to participate in school activities. We became ad- justed to the school schedule and many of our names ap- peared on the honor roll. Following the summer vacation most of us were eager to return to our classes and friends. Now we were eighters , familiar with life at Harrold and anxious to join clubs and participate in activities. Among the most important was the student council election, for now we were able to choose a fellow student to represent us in our student government. We attended many of the dances and sport activities sponsor- ed by our school. As our secondyear at Harrold came to an end we anticipated the coming year for we would be the lead- ers. Finally we were Freshmen. Realizing this would be our last year at Harrold, we were eager to take part in activities. When we were not the active leaders, we were the active supporters. In addition to studying, we held offices, took part in sports, participated in assemblies and played in the .band and orchestra. This year we all had two new subjects, science and civics. French, a new subject offered to us this year, and algebra were also a challenge for many of us. As this year came to an end, our alma mater had a new meaning to us. It represented three years of learning through study and experience. Harrold was our second step along the road of education, a step that prepared us for high school. Al- though we regret leaving Harrold, we can think back over our memories and say with pride, I was a Harrold Student. 48 WQJWD WW fg jVfQifif 3 W, Ugjiwfji fi 5 ' 5 l ffwwy J v 7 A q 4 W fp WA 4 'X Ms' ww!
